AtkinsRéalis is one of the world’s most respected design, engineering, and project management consultancies. We are looking to recruit environmental consultants with solid experience to support the growth of infrastructure projects in the energy, water, rail, and highways sectors in the UK, with significant opportunities overseas.

We are looking for an individual with practical experience of environmental coordination, assessment, and management to join our Planning, Environmental Consenting and Communities (PECC) team in Glasgow. You will join a national team of over 150 planning and environmental assessment and management professionals providing the environmental services that facilitate the consenting and delivery of projects from feasibility through to construction obtaining permissions and facilitating sustainable solutions for our clients. Key clients in this region include Transport Scotland, Scottish Water, local authorities, and a number of private developers.

This is an excellent career development opportunity for a candidate looking to progress their career to the next level in a fast paced and exciting industry. You will work collaboratively with a range of technical specialists on a broad range of projects, assisting with the co-ordination of Environmental Impacts Assessments and related deliverables.

The successful candidate will be educated to degree level in an environmental or related discipline and have a good understanding of all the technical specialisms required for an EIA. You will be a working towards chartership through IEMA or other professional body. Responsibilities:

  • Assisting on the coordination and delivery of environmental work being undertaken by multi-disciplinary teams including EIA, options appraisals, and environmental management.
  • Collate and edit information from a range of sources to provide clear, well written reports.
    Competently undertake own work to an excellent standard on time and to budget.
  • Have a presence in the Glasgow office and act as a conduit for the PECC team from the other environmental and engineering teams in Glasgow.
  • Compliance with Health and Safety Policies and Procedures, including preparation of H&S Plans for site surveys.
  • Supporting senior management with bid preparation and project management to ensure projects are delivered on-time, on budget and to quality and client expectations.
  • Undertake Continual Professional Development in accordance with requirements of chosen professional institute.

Requirements:

  • Degree or Masters in an environmental or science subject.
  • Working toward chartership with a relevant professional body.
  • Experience working on linear infrastructure projects (rail/road) would be beneficial.
  • Good knowledge of the EIA process and environmental technical specialisms.
  • Strong report writing, verbal and presentation skills.
  • Able to prioritise and work effectively under pressure.
  • Good interpersonal skills and an ability to communicate issues and ideas effectively.
  • Be flexible, adaptable, and prepared to take on new challenges and work from other AtkinsRéalis or client office locations.
  • Be highly self-motivated, possessing strong enthusiasm and commitment to delivering sustainable outcomes.

This role may require security clearance and offers of employment will be dependent on obtaining the relevant level of clearanceIf this is necessary, it will be discussed with you at interview. The vetting process is delivered by United Kingdom Security Vetting (UKSV) and may require candidates to provide proof of residency in the UK of 5 years or longer. If applying to this role please do not make reference to (in conversation) or include in your application or CV, details of any current or previously held security clearance.
